The email warmup tool, upgraded for deliverability.
Mailwarm 2.0 is an advanced email warmup and deliverability platform designed to help founders, marketers, and sales teams ensure their outreach emails land directly in inboxes. Building on its predecessor, Mailwarm 2.0 integrates automated warmup sequences with real engagement signals, monitoring tools, and infrastructure checks to optimize email reputation. Its unique combination of automation and expert support makes it especially suitable for startups and growing businesses aiming to boost email deliverability without technical overhead. By simulating natural email interactions and providing actionable insights, Mailwarm 2.0 helps users build a healthy sender reputation, reduce bounce rates, and improve overall email campaign success.

AI presentations without the AI slop
Chronicle 2.0 is an innovative AI-powered presentation design tool tailored for professionals, educators, and entrepreneurs who need visually compelling slides quickly and efficiently. By transforming notes, prompts, or existing decks into polished, on-brand presentations, Chronicle streamlines the often time-consuming process of slide creation. Its intelligent system asks simple questions to generate a strong first draft, which users can then refine through an intuitive conversational interface, ensuring the final product aligns perfectly with their vision. What sets Chronicle apart is its focus on quality and on-brand consistency, avoiding the typical 'AI slop' seen in less refined tools. This makes it ideal for users seeking both speed and professionalism in their presentation workflows.
